Carnivores and Communities: Program Case Study and Summary are now published!

Carnivores and Communities: A Case Study of Human-Carnivore Conflict Mitigation in Southwestern Alberta In 2018, the Waterton Biosphere Reserve Association used an online survey to evaluate the effectiveness of the CACP directly from the program participants’ perspectives and experiences.
